package main
import (
"bufio"
"encoding/json"
"fmt"
"io/ioutil"
"log"
"net/http"
"net/http/cookiejar"
"net/url"
"os"
"sort"
"strconv"
"strings"
"time"
)
type Booklist struct {
Booklist struct {
Booklist struct {
Name string `json:"name"`
BookIds []string `json:"bookIds"`
Description string `json:"description"`
BooklistId string `json:"booklistId"`
TotalCount int `json:"totalCount"`
CollectCount int `json:"collectCount"`
} `json:"booklist"`
} `json:"booklist"`
}
type Booklists struct {
Booklists []struct {
BooklistId string `json:"booklistId"`
CollectCount int `json:"collectCount"`
Name string `json:"name"`
Description string `json:"description"`
TotalCount int `json:"totalCount"`
} `json:"booklists"`
}
type BookInfo struct {
BookId string `json:"bookId"`
Title string `json:"title"`
Author string `json:"author"`
Cover string `json:"cover"`
Category string `json:"category"`
Intro string `json:"intro"`
Publisher string `json:"publisher"`
PublishTime string `json:"publishTime"`
BookSize int `json:"bookSize"`
Star int `json:"star"`
NewRatingCount int `json:"newRatingCount"`
}
type BestBookMarkItem struct {
Bookid string `json:"bookId"`
Uservid string `json:"userVid"`
Bookmarkid string `json:"bookmarkId"`
Chapteruid int `json:"chapterUid"`
Range string `json:"range"`
Marktext string `json:"markText"`
Totalcount int `json:"totalCount"`
}
type BestBookMarks struct {
Totalcount string `json:"totalCount"`
Items []BestBookMarkItem `json:"items"`
Chapters []struct {
Bookid string `json:"bookId"`
Chapteruid int `json:"chapterUid"`
Chapteridx int `json:"chapterIdx"`
Title string `json:"title"`
} `json:"chapters"`
}
func check(err error) {
if err != nil {
log.Fatal(err)
}
}
func main() {
getBookLists()
}
func getBookLists() {
result, err := getAndSaveResponse("booklists", "https://i.weread.qq.com/market/booklists?count=200&type=0")
check(err)
var booklists Booklists
json.Unmarshal([]byte(result), &booklists)
f, err := os.Create("README.md")
check(err)
defer f.Close()
fmt.Fprintln(f, "# 微信读书热门收藏书单")
for index, booklist := range booklists.Booklists {
log.Println(index, booklist.Name, booklist.CollectCount, booklist.TotalCount)
fmt.Fprintln(f, "\n###", strconv.Itoa(index+1), booklist.Name)
fmt.Fprintln(f, "\n"+booklist.Description)
bookIds, err := getBookList(booklist.BooklistId)
check(err)
fmt.Fprintln(f, "\n<details>\n<summary>"+strconv.Itoa(booklist.TotalCount)+" books, "+strconv.Itoa(booklist.CollectCount)+" likes"+"</summary>")
for index, bookId := range bookIds {
if index > 30 {
break
}
bookInfo := getBookInfo(bookId)
booklist.Name = strings.TrimSpace(booklist.Name)
booklist.Name = strings.ReplaceAll(booklist.Name, " ", "%20")
booklist.Name = strings.ReplaceAll(booklist.Name, "/", "-")
bookInfo.Title = strings.ReplaceAll(bookInfo.Title, "/", "-")
fmt.Fprintf(f, "\n1. [%s](books/%s/%s.md)", bookInfo.Title, booklist.Name, strings.ReplaceAll(bookInfo.Title, " ", "%20"))
bestMark := getBestBookMarks(bookInfo, booklist.Name)
if bestMark.Totalcount > 300 {
fmt.Fprintln(f, "\n\t> "+strconv.Itoa(bestMark.Totalcount)+" "+bestMark.Marktext)
}
}
fmt.Fprintln(f, "\n</details>")
// os.Exit(1)
}
}
func getBookInfo(bookId string) BookInfo {
result, err := getAndSaveResponse(bookId+"-bookinfo", "https://i.weread.qq.com/book/info?bookId="+bookId)
check(err)
var bookInfo BookInfo
json.Unmarshal([]byte(result), &bookInfo)
check(err)
return bookInfo
}
func getBookList(booklistId string) ([]string, error) {
result, err := getAndSaveResponse(booklistId, "https://i.weread.qq.com/booklist/single?booklistId="+booklistId)
check(err)
var booklist Booklist
json.Unmarshal([]byte(result), &booklist)
bl := booklist.Booklist.Booklist
bl.Name = strings.TrimSpace(bl.Name)
bl.Name = strings.ReplaceAll(bl.Name, "/", "-")
bl.Name = strings.ReplaceAll(bl.Name, "%20", " ")
path := "books/" + bl.Name
if _, err := os.Stat(path); os.IsNotExist(err) {
err := os.Mkdir(path, 0755)
check(err)
}
return bl.BookIds, err
}
func getAndSaveResponse(id, URL string) ([]byte, error) {
fileName := "temp/" + id + ".json"
if _, err := os.Stat(fileName); os.IsNotExist(err) {
rawCookies, err := ioutil.ReadFile("cookie.txt")
check(err)
rawRequest := fmt.Sprintf("GET / HTTP/1.0\r\n%s\r\n\r\n", rawCookies)
req, _ := http.ReadRequest(bufio.NewReader(strings.NewReader(rawRequest)))
url, _ := url.Parse(URL)
jar, _ := cookiejar.New(nil)
jar.SetCookies(url, req.Cookies())
client := http.Client{Jar: jar}
request, _ := http.NewRequest("GET", URL, nil)
request.Header.Set("user-agent", "Mozilla/5.0 (Macintosh; Intel Mac OS X 10.15; rv:88.0) Gecko/20100101 Firefox/88.0")
r, err := client.Do(request)
check(err)
defer r.Body.Close()
body, _ := ioutil.ReadAll(r.Body)
err = ioutil.WriteFile("temp/"+id+".json", body, 0644)
check(err)
log.Println("StatusCode:", r.StatusCode, id, "from:", url, "saved")
time.Sleep(200 * time.Millisecond)
return body, err
}
body, err := ioutil.ReadFile(fileName)
if strings.Contains(string(body), "errcode") {
os.Remove(fileName)
log.Fatal(string(body))
}
return body, err
}
func getBestBookMarks(bookInfo BookInfo, booklistName string) BestBookMarkItem {
bookId := bookInfo.BookId
booklistName = strings.ReplaceAll(booklistName, "%20", " ")
booklistName = strings.ReplaceAll(booklistName, "/", "-")
f, err := os.Create("books/" + booklistName + "/" + strings.ReplaceAll(bookInfo.Title, "/", "-") + ".md")
check(err)
defer f.Close()
fmt.Fprintln(f, "## "+bookInfo.Title)
fmt.Fprintln(f, "\n"+bookInfo.Author, " - ", bookInfo.Category)
fmt.Fprintln(f, "\n> "+bookInfo.Intro)
result, err := getAndSaveResponse(bookId, "https://i.weread.qq.com/book/bestbookmarks?count=5000&bookId="+bookId)
check(err)
var bestBookMarks BestBookMarks
json.Unmarshal([]byte(result), &bestBookMarks)
// sort chapters and marks
sort.Slice(bestBookMarks.Chapters, func(i, j int) bool {
return bestBookMarks.Chapters[i].Chapteruid < bestBookMarks.Chapters[j].Chapteruid
})
sort.Slice(bestBookMarks.Items, func(i, j int) bool {
range1, _ := strconv.Atoi(strings.Split(bestBookMarks.Items[i].Range, "-")[0])
range2, _ := strconv.Atoi(strings.Split(bestBookMarks.Items[j].Range, "-")[0])
return range1 < range2
})
if len(bestBookMarks.Items) > 0 {
bestMark := bestBookMarks.Items[0]
for _, v := range bestBookMarks.Chapters {
fmt.Fprintln(f, "\n###", v.Title)
for i := 0; i < len(bestBookMarks.Items); i++ {
if bestBookMarks.Items[i].Chapteruid == v.Chapteruid {
fmt.Fprintln(f, "\n"+bestBookMarks.Items[i].Marktext+" c:"+strconv.Itoa(bestBookMarks.Items[i].Totalcount))
}
if bestBookMarks.Items[i].Totalcount > bestMark.Totalcount {
bestMark = bestBookMarks.Items[i]
}
}
}
if bestMark.Totalcount > 10 {
// log.Println(bestMark.Totalcount, bestMark.Marktext)
return bestMark
}
}
return BestBookMarkItem{}
}
